Rodney Strong 2004 Merlot, Sonoma County To some people, Merlot may seem like a new kid on the block. But at Rodney Strong Vineyards we've been growing it since the early 1970s, when Rod Strong first planted Merlot in Geyserville, the heart of the Alexander Valley.
Today, Rodney Strong farms over 100 acres in the Alexander Valley and the northern portion of the Russian River Valley. Together, these areas display the bright, red fruit character of the Russian River with the deep dark fruit flavors and mature tannins of the warmer Alexander Valley.
Plum and blueberry flavors predominate in this soft, rich, mouth filling Merlot, and are enhanced by aging in small oak barrels for a toasty, spicy vanilla character, and a lingering berry-cream finish. Drink this satisfying Merlot over the next 2 to 4 years. |
